What this shows is the story of how we’ll manage the temperature at both locations, keeping it in the appropriate range. Rather than assaulting heat with a more traditional air conditioner, we treat the heat generated by the DataCenter as a resource, and send it to the appropriate destination depending on need. When the heat isn’t needed by the greenhouse – such as summertime, or days when the sun through the glass provides adequate warmth – heat is redirected to geothermal wells, where it dissipates into the ground.
